| As the use of growth-promoting antibiotics is further restricted,it is particularly important to develop new antibiotic alternatives to promote growth of livestock and poultry.Traditional Chinese medicine has the advantages of low cost,environmental friendliness,and resistance to drug resistance.It is one of the directions worth exploring in the field of growth promoters for livestock and poultry.The compound Chinese veterinary medicine "Zhenqi Granules"(ZQG)developed by our laboratory in cooperation with the company in the early stage uses Ligustrum lucidum and Astragalus as raw materials.Preliminary experimental results show that the compound Chinese veterinary medicine has a significant effect on promoting pig growth.In order to evaluate the safety of the Chinese veterinary drug preparation and clarify its possible adverse reactions,this study carried out acute toxicity and subacute toxicity tests.At the same time,the effect of the compound Chinese veterinary medicine on the levels of growth-related hormones in mice was preliminarily explored.The main results obtained are as follows:In the acute toxicity test,mice were given ZQG solution with different dosages(0~50 mg/10g·bw)by intragastric administration,all the mice were still alive.So,the maximum tolerance test was conducted at 50mg/10g·bw dose,and the results showed that all the mice had no death and abnormal performance.The maximum tolerance of ZQG on mice was greater than 50mg/10 g.bw.According to the "Technical Guidelines for Acute Toxicity Studies of Chemical Drugs",the entire acute toxicity test can be ended if the mice have not died at a dose of 50 mg/10 g·bw.In the subacute toxicity study,according to the Chinese Veterinary Pharmacopoeia and the "Methodology of Traditional Chinese Medicine Pharmacology" compiled by Chen Qi and others,for new veterinary drugs with a clinical course of less than two weeks,choosing a subacute toxicity cycle of one month can be well supported.One-step clinical trial.Because the clinical course of ZQG is within two weeks,we choose a 30-day administration cycler.Rats were given the drug by gavage at high,medium and low doses(50.0,25.0 and 12.5 mg/10g·bw)once a day for 30 days.The results showed that there were no abnormalities in behavior,spirit,feeding,drinking water,feces and body weight in the experimental group of rats treated with high,medium and low dose compound ZQG compared with the control group.At the end of the experiment,the blood routine indexes and blood biochemical indexes of the rats were tested,and the results showed that there were a few statistical differences between the ZQG treated rats and the control rats.However,except for the high dose group,the indexes of glutamate transaminase were higher than the normal reference range.After continuous administration for 15 and 30 days,the viscera coefficients of each group were determined,and the results showed that there was no significant difference between the rats in the administration group and the blank control group,and no pathological changes related to the effects of the drug were found in the histopathological examination.In the experiment to evaluate the effect of ZQG on the growth hormone level of mice,three dose groups(3.40,1.70,0.85mg/10g·bw)of ZQG(3.40,1.70,0.85mg/10g·bw)and Wuweijianpi granule(WJP)group(5.10)were set.mg/10g·bw),and five test groups as a blank control group(equal volume of saline).Gavage twice a day for 7 days.On the 3rd and 7th day of administration and on the 3rd and 7th day after drug withdrawal,the weight and food intake of mice in each dose group were weighed and recorded.On the 7th day of administration and the 7th day of drug withdrawal,half of the mice in each group were killed respectively,and the organs were separated and the organ coefficients were measured.The serum was taken to determine the contents of the four hormones of GH,T3,T4 and IGF-1.Analysis of the significance of the difference.The results showed that the average body weight,daily gain,and daily feed intake of the mice in each dose group of ZQG were greater than those of the blank control group in the 7 days of administration and 7 days of drug withdrawal,but there was no significant difference between the two groups.Sexual difference(p>0.05).There were no significant differences in the organ coefficients of the heart,liver,spleen,lung and kidney of the mice in each dose group of ZQG and the WJP group and the blank group(p>0.05).The results of hormone determination in mice showed that on the 7th day of administration,the contents of the four hormones in the serum of the mice in each dose group of ZQG were significantly greater than that of the blank control group(p<0.05);The levels of the four hormones in the serum of mice in each dose group of ZQG were also significantly higher than those of the blank control group(p <0.05).Based on the above results,ZQG has no obvious acute and subacute toxic effects,and can increase the hormone levels of GH,T3,T4,and IGF-1 in the serum of mice. |
